Linux-User-Manager

Linux Project To Deal Directly With Operating System Terminal To Execute Specific Tasks Through Interface Without Going Into Command/Terminal Details .

Specialized In :

-Adding And Deleting Users In System.

-Adding And Deleting Groups In System.

-Change User Information.

-Change Password Expiration Information For Each User (Min Days - Max Days - Date - Warning Time).

-Change User's Password Expires.

-Assign Specific Users To Specific Groups.


It's Including :

-Menu Interface To Let The User Picks The Option He Wants.

-Manual Page For Your Project.


How to Use ?

1- Select Your File Scope and File name.

2- Open Your Terminal (Ctrl+alt+t).

3- Wrire Following : Cd Foldername

4- Build Your Code : gcc FileName.c -o FileName.out

5- Run Your Code : ./filename.out


*Note : Replace "Foldername" With The Name Of The Folder/place That You Keep Your File AND Replace "Filename" With The Name Of The File That You Want To Run It.
